ADT TEAMS WITH MICROSOFT TO EXPAND DELIVERY OF SENSORMATIC ANALYTICS BUSINESS INTELLIGENCE SOLUTIONS

ADT Delivers Innovative Store Business Intelligence Suite that Operates on a Microsoft Software Platform to Help Retailers Manage Store Data.

BOCA RATON, Fla. – January 11, 2010 – ADT Security Services, the world’s largest provider of electronic security services to the retail industry, today announced it is delivering Sensormatic Analytics store business intelligence solutions based on Microsoft SQL Server 2008.  The technology advantages of Microsoft software give ADT retail customers the ability to improve investigative capabilities to identify fraud and assess operational metrics.

ADT provides a comprehensive store business intelligence suite which can be integrated with video surveillance to help retailers enhance operational performance and meet their financial goals. By deploying Sensormatic Analytics built on Microsoft SQL Server 2008, ADT can leverage the retailer’s existing IT infrastructure and workforce to expedite the implementation process. As a reporting and performance improvement tool for retail operations, the Sensormatic Analytics suite is designed to provide retailers with actionable data to help uncover various sources of store losses.

Retailers are looking to Sensormatic Analytics with Microsoft software to make effective use of vast amounts of data from their video surveillance systems.  The solution is ideal for supermarket, apparel, drug, discount, and specialty store chains to satisfy their need for business intelligence that can help control theft and improve operational efficiencies.

“With inventory shrinkage due to shoplifting, employee theft, vendor fraud and administrative error costing U.S. retailers more than $36 billion last year, retailers must tap into the next generation of store-level business intelligence solutions to save critical dollars,” said David Gruehn, U.S. retail industry solutions director, Microsoft Corp. “ADT’s Sensormatic Analytics solutions, based on Microsoft SQL Server 2008, enable retailers to maximize integrated smart technology and advanced data analytics to prevent losses, improve operations and keep profits higher.”

According to Jeff Bean, vice president of Retail Sales and Operations for ADT, the active collaboration with Microsoft strengthens ADT’s position as a leading provider of store business intelligence technologies.

“Rather than combing through manual reports and logs, retailers can now have an accurate picture painted for them about what’s going on in their stores.”  Bean said.  “Nothing could be clearer than a video showing no customer in line while a cashier is processing a refund. It is just one example of the benefits available from this combined solution,” he added.

About ADT Security Services
ADT Security Services, a unit of Tyco International, is the largest provider of electronic security services to more than seven million commercial, government and residential customers worldwide. ADT's total security solutions include intrusion, fire protection, closed circuit television, access control, critical condition monitoring, electronic article surveillance, radio frequency identification (RFID) and integrated systems. About the Sensormatic Retail Solutions Portfolio
The industry-leading Sensormatic Retail Solutions portfolio offers vital loss prevention and operational improvement technologies and solutions. Backed by more than 1,500 patents, the Sensormatic solutions portfolio is sold through ADT and authorized business partners around the world. From the front of the store through the entire retail supply chain, Sensormatic solutions help keep losses lower – and profits higher. Today, over 80 percent of world's top 200 retailers that use EAS rely on Sensormatic solutions, which include EAS, source-tagging, data analytics and in-store, item-level intelligence applications. Sensormatic forward-thinking solutions also include dual EAS-RFID technology that provides item-level security and visibility in an ever changing retail environment.
